2.8-trillion-parameter AI model Kimi K3 has been released by China's Moonshot AI, marking a significant milestone in the global AI arms race and the open-source AI movement.

Introduction to Kimi K3

Moonshot AI, backed by Alibaba, has made a dramatic comeback with the release of Kimi K3, which benchmarks show performs neck-and-neck with top US systems from Anthropic and OpenAI. The model's full weights are scheduled to be released on July 27, according to details shared by researchers who reviewed the company's technical documentation. 70% of the model's development was focused on improving its natural language processing capabilities, with 30% dedicated to multilingual support.
